Pulsar broke a galactic filament in the Milky Way

gizmodo.com

A fast-spinning neutron star, or pulsar, has been identified as the cause of a break in a massive galactic filament within the Milky Way. The pulsar, traveling at high speeds, collided with the 230-light-year-long filament, G359.13, distorting its magnetic field and creating a visible fracture. This was discovered using X-ray images from the Chandra Observatory and radio data. The filament, resembling a bone, is located near the Milky Way's center. This event highlights the ongoing chaotic activity within our galaxy, which astronomers continue to study using advanced instruments.
